In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(CS:GO), support roles are essential to team success, often acting as the backbone in a well-coordinated strategy. A support player is typically responsible for utilizing utility items, such as smoke grenades, flashbangs, and molotov cocktails, to create opportunities for their teammates. This player’s actions can significantly influence the outcome of rounds by controlling sight lines and obstructing enemy movements. Additionally, a support player often prioritizes their teammates’ survival by providing cover and ensuring that key areas are held, giving the team a tactical advantage.
The impact of support roles goes beyond just the immediate gameplay mechanics; their decisions can shape the team's overall strategy and morale. By effectively communication and coordinating with others, support players can facilitate better positioning and synergy among teammates. Moreover, when a support player consistently performs well, it can boost the team's confidence and elevate their level of play. In essence, understanding the key responsibilities of support roles is crucial for any aspiring CS:GO player, as these roles ensure that everyone is functioning at their best, ultimately leading to higher chances of victory.
